Definition
整容 is a separable verb (离合词) meaning 'to undergo cosmetic surgery' — the noun 容 ('appearance') can split from 整 ('to fix') to insert measure words, duration, or other modifiers, as in 整了几次容. The word also has a casual sense 'to spruce up' (e.g., getting a haircut or dressing neatly), but in HSK 7 contexts it almost always refers to medical aesthetic procedures like a face-lift or rhinoplasty.

Examples
- ,整容。Tā duì zìjǐ bízi bú tài mǎnyì, suǒyǐ qù zhěng róng le.She wasn't happy with her nose, so she got plastic surgery.
- ,,。Wǒ jiějie zhěng guò liǎng cì róng, yí cì shì yǎnjīng, yí cì shì xiàba.My sister had plastic surgery twice — once on her eyes and once on her chin.
- ,整容。Cānjiā hūnlǐ qián, tā huā le yí ge xiǎoshí zhěng róng zìjǐ.Before the wedding, she spent an hour sprucing herself up.
